Abstract

节能精馏塔,包括精馏塔(1)、直道管(5),其特征在于,直道管(5)外四周装有冷凝管(2);冷凝管(2)下面有一进水口(6),上面有一出水口(7)。本实用新型创造结构简单、能很好地利用直道管(5)上的热能,并能将出水口(7)上的热水充分利用,还能减少冷凝管(2)的能量消耗。

Description

节能精馏塔
    (一)技术领域
    本发明创造涉及一种节能精馏塔。
    (二)背景技术
化工等企业经常需要用到精馏塔,有些物料需要在精馏塔中加热到一定温度反应一些时间,出去的气体没有很好地被利用热能。
(三)发明内容
本发明创造要解决的技术问题是:针对上述问题,提供一种结构简单、能很好地利用热能的节能精馏塔。
本发明创造的技术方案是:节能精馏塔,包括精馏塔、直道管,其特征在于,直道管外四周装有冷凝管;冷凝管下面有一进水口,上面有一出水口。本发明创造结构简单、能很好地利用直道管上的热能,并能将出水口上的热水充分利用,还能减少冷凝管的能量消耗。
